在编程的世界里,打印输出函数就像是我们与计算机沟通的桥梁。它让我们能够看到程序的运行状态,理解程序的逻辑,以及验证代码的正确性。不同的编程语言提供了各自独特的打印输出方法,但它们的基本目标都是一致的:将信息展示给用户。接下来,我们将深入探讨一些常见编程语言中的打印输出函数,了解它们的用法和特点。
Python:简洁的print()函数
Python的print()函数是如此简单易用,几乎每个Python程序员都会使用它。它可以直接输出文本,也可以输出变量的值。以下是一些基本的print()用法示例:
# 输出简单的文本
print("这是一个打印的例子")
# 输出变量的值
name = "Python"
print("我喜欢", name)
Python的print()函数还可以接受多个参数,并且支持格式化输出:
# 格式化输出
print("数字:", 123, "文本:", "Hello")
Java:标准输出System.out.println()
Java的System.out.println()是控制台输出的基本方法。它和Python的print()非常相似,但Java更倾向于使用分号来分隔表达式。
// 输出简单的文本
System.out.println("这是一个打印的例子");
// 输出变量的值
String language = "Java";
System.out.println("我喜欢" + language);
C/C++:灵活的printf()函数
C和C++中的printf()函数功能非常强大,它允许程序员按照特定的格式输出多种类型的数据。
#include <stdio.h>
int main() {
// 输出简单的文本
printf("这是一个打印的例子\n");
// 输出变量的值
int number = 123;
printf("数字:%d\n", number);
return 0;
}
JavaScript:控制台日志console.log()
JavaScript的console.log()是浏览器开发中的常用工具,用于在控制台输出信息。
// 输出简单的文本
console.log("这是一个打印的例子");
// 输出变量的值
let language = "JavaScript";
console.log("我喜欢", language);
打印输出函数的特点
尽管不同的编程语言提供了不同的打印输出函数,但它们通常具有以下共同特点:
- 输出文本信息:打印函数可以输出简单的字符串信息。
- 输出变量值:通过将变量作为参数传递,可以输出变量的当前值。
- 格式化输出:大多数打印函数支持格式化输出,允许插入特殊字符和转义序列。
- 输出到不同设备:虽然大多数情况下打印到控制台,但某些函数也可能支持将输出写入文件或其他设备。
总之,打印输出函数是编程中不可或缺的一部分,它们帮助我们理解程序的行为,并在调试过程中起到关键作用。通过掌握不同编程语言的打印输出方法,我们可以更加自信地构建复杂的程序。
